4years wrote:
Nationes Pii Redivivi wrote:

I understand dictatorship of the proletariat to mean a government of the proletariat, but 1. any government at all would be an impedement to total freedom and Communism, whether it be a bourgeois dictatorship or a proletarian dictatorship. 2. A truly communist society would transcend class and government, where 3. Marxist's 'transitional' government has the power to stay pernament and create a new class and a new hierarchical structure.


1. Incorrect. Communism, or any other anarchic ideology, will have a government. It is the state that is abolished.


And a dictatorship of the proletariat is not a state?

A truly communistic society, that is, founded upon free association of producers, would have no government, nor any need of it.

2. A communist society would abolish the state, not the government.


What is your distinction between a state and a government?

I do not see how a society founded upon equals would need government at all.

3. You can't just leap from capitalist society to communism. You must a have a socialist transitional phase, a dictatorship of the proletariat. Money, class, and the state or to ingrained to abolish them overnight.


Why not?

When one fight against feudalism, one does not install feudalism mild and say that this is the correct approach because feudalism is too ingrained into society, nor does one go about saying that blacks should live in semi-slavery because 'they are not used to freedom yet'.
